Why is knowing your target heart rate important?

Understanding your target heart rate is crucial because it specifically guides exercise intensity for cardiovascular improvement. The target heart rate represents a range that reflects the optimal level of exertion during aerobic activities. When exercising within this range, individuals can effectively enhance their cardiovascular endurance and overall heart health. Staying within the target heart rate zone ensures that the body is working hard enough to elevate the heart rate for fitness benefits without exceeding levels that may lead to fatigue or compromise safety.

While managing hydration, recovery periods, and injury prevention are all important aspects of an overall fitness plan, they are not directly related to the primary function of knowing your target heart rate. Instead, the focus on intensity is what makes monitoring the target heart rate essential in achieving specific cardiovascular fitness goals.
